Planning on getting a new gear knob and gaiter for the impreza....but unsure which one to go for....two possibilities at the moment....

Option 1

Momo Race Air Knob


black leather, and would match the steering wheel pretty well
there's one on ebay at the moment, so could potentially get it pretty cheap, or I've been offered one from someone else for £30


Option 2

Prodrive Black Alloy Knob


A bit pricier...I think about £50, but I like it....

cant decide whether the leather would look better in the car though....
I'm so crap at visualising things

what do you think?
